Insurance underwriters used to spend a great part of their work day cold calling people who, numerous times, did not want to be got hold of. These days, insurance marketing for insurance agents includesobtaining qualified leads from leadgen websites. These insurance lead websites offer a cost efficient substitute to lists and other marketing methods.
Leadgen sites provide a great product for agents searching for more sales. These sites first gather data from consumers interested in a new insurance policy through their own websites. Then, they use the information submitted to pair each user with localized brokers.
There are many different insurance leadgen companies, each claiming to have the most targeted sales leads. How are you supposed to figure out which insurance lead company to use? You should look for a company that can regularly offer quality leads with prices that can bring a great return on invested capital, a fair billing system and return policy, a system to filter your sales leads and that the prospects are delivered in real time.
The price you pay for each insurance lead is one way to review an insurance lead company. However, you have to know that more expensive leads may bring in an increased number of customers than lower priced leads. It seems that most of the time, you get what you pay for.
Some insurance lead generation companies try to get you to make a large deposit before sending you insurance leads. With so many insurance lead generation websites allowing you to begin receiving leads with $100 or some that will invoice you after you receive leads, there is no reason to deposit too much up front.
No matter which lead company you use, you’ll eventually be sold a lead that fake information or is a duplicate. A worthwhile insurance lead company will also have a great refund
return policy for these kinds of insurance leads.
Lead filters help eliminate low quality prospects. A sales lead company should give you filtering abilities including geotargeting and lead specific filters. Much of the time, you will have to pay more to create filters, as you will receive higher quality consumers, but the extra fee is usually worth the added fee.
In summary, when evaluating a lead company, you should shop around and try out various insurance lead websites. You may see that a couple offer superior life insurance sales leads but don’t offer great automobile insurance sales leads. If you generate leads from different sources, it will give you an edge against other agents and will keep the volume of your leads in check.
